Capt. Hill, who left Boston on Wednesday the 12th Instant, informs, that, just before his departure, a brig arrived there from Virginia, loaded with pork in her hold, and live stock, such as hogs and poultry, upon deck; the master's name he forgot, but described him to be a slim man, about 5 feet 8 inches high, dark complexion, wore his own dark hair, and light coloured sagathy clothes. The brig was about 100 tons burthen, with yellow sides, and came from James river, the Captain (Hill) believes from Norfolk. She was cleared out from Jamaica, and her cargo was delivered to the King's contractor at Boston. Captain Hill asked the mate of the brig whether any of his hands had been pressed. He answered, no; that the business they came upon was of such a nature as prevented it.
